TORSION BAR ADJUSTMENT

The bump stops are the only thing you have to worry about. Well, and getting the right alignment numbers.

Nothing changes with spring rate by adjusting the torsion bar bolts. The car weighs the same, there is no “twist” added to the bars, the adjusting lever just sits at a different angle to the torsion bar hex.
